My Students

Over 90% of our students receive free or reduced price lunch. While 40% of our students are considered English language learners, Spanish is the home language of 90% of our students. Many of our students are struggling readers, but work hard to reach their reading and math goals during the school year.

The students are excited, engaged, curious, hard workers and are eager to become better readers and mathematicians.

During math, we are solving multi-step word problems using addition, subtraction, multiplication and division and expressing our different methods for solving, while analyzing right and wrong answers.

My Project

Our students are inquisitive, creative and curious. In math, our tiniest mathematicians are learning to count, about the numbers around them and to make connections. Now, we're going to get their families in on the fun!

Math is so much more than just finding an answer--it's about collaborating with our fellow mathematicians, making our thinking visible and sharing our thoughts.

Math isn't just in our text books, but everywhere in the world around us.

In order to be successful, we need to see what we are learning.

So many children are growing up and saying "I'm not a math person" because they struggled to make sense of their learning at a young age. To combat this, we want to develop a sense of love and engagement in mathematics so our students grow up LOVING math and fulfill their potential as engineers, mathematicians, scientists, artists and anything else they can imagine.

The resources for this project will be to support our Family Math Night this fall for our mathematicians to participate with their loved ones. Students & families will learn more about the math models & manipulatives we're using in the classroom and more importantly, create games and resources to take home and have fun!
